description abstractAn optical technique is described for determining, in a physically nondisturbing manner, the thickness of a thin flowing liquid film. The technique is based on measurement of the fluorescent emission induced in the liquid film by absorption of a focused laser beam. Although the technique was developed for measuring liquid film thicknesses on the prefilming surface of an airblast fuel atomizer, it is not limited to this application.
